So, 'Hitler's Zombie Army' is this wild documentary that dives into some fringe theories about WWII. It’s not your typical history piece; it really leans into the bizarre blend of Nazism and the occult. The pacing can be a bit uneven at times, making some segments feel almost like a fever dream. The tone, though, is surprisingly engaging, as it intersperses archival footage with interviews in a way that feels almost sinister. The practical effects, while not the focal point, certainly add a bizarre texture to the narrative. It’s interesting how it challenges the traditional war documentary vibe, opening up discussions on superstition and power. Not everyone's cup of tea, but definitely a distinctive take on a well-trodden subject.
